Output 51512060b130cdb240b1f87e9a1885968a23e5902d42e29d15c26508939ed3d8:0

value
12099844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0e03d6a40a3b42776e1d30065bba10c82639e5e OP_EQUAL
address
3GMefhSyU5SE9ZKMtqJrZknKXmC3M71pPv
transaction
51512060b130cdb240b1f87e9a1885968a23e5902d42e29d15c26508939ed3d8
spent
true